Sometimes, I get PCBs from the chaps at Fuzzdog, mostly only if I can't find something anywhere else, because I generally don't like their side jacks and power" approach. Going for top jacks and power often means that all the controls have to be moved down ... or do off-board wiring.

So, this one is supposed to be the OBNE Haunt, a high gain gated fuzz with blend and two switches for tonal options. Sounds great on bass!

Then, the DBA Absolute Destruction, "designed to make your signal sound like all your gear is broken". Well, there are some big fat fuzz sounds in there too, but yeah, mostly all kinds of crazy and/or broken sounds when adjusting LOAD and GAIN. I like those wacky DBA designs and this one is no exception.

And the Dunwich 3-knob hybrid Cthulhu Fuzz. Funny wiring because I've tried to build this one on a vero layout based on the Fuzzdog schematic, but I couldn't get it to work properly and after some frustrating debugging attempts, I just grabbed the PCB from Fuzzdog with my last order ...... and then used the already drilled enclosure and most parts from the vero build.
Sounds absolutely massive, that Depth control is great ..... (I upped the bigger cap to 1.5uf, left the other at 15N).
Something Russian in the GE tranistor spot.
